2911791816 has 24 divisors (see below), whose sum is σ = 7886103030. Its totient is φ = 970597248.
The previous prime is 2911791803. The next prime is 2911791829. The reversal of 2911791816 is 6181971192.
It is a happy number.
2911791816 is digitally balanced in base 2, because in such base it contains all the possibile digits an equal number of times.
It is an interprime number because it is at equal distance from previous prime (2911791803) and next prime (2911791829).
It can be written as a sum of positive squares in only one way, i.e., 2906288100 + 5503716 = 53910^2 + 2346^2 .
It is a tau number, because it is divible by the number of its divisors (24).
It is an unprimeable number.
It is a polite number, since it can be written in 5 ways as a sum of consecutive naturals, for example, 20220705 + ... + 20220848.
Almost surely, 22911791816 is an apocalyptic number.
It is an amenable number.
2911791816 is an abundant number, since it is smaller than the sum of its proper divisors (4974311214).
It is a pseudoperfect number, because it is the sum of a subset of its proper divisors.
2911791816 is a wasteful number, since it uses less digits than its factorization.
2911791816 is an evil number, because the sum of its binary digits is even.
The sum of its prime factors is 40441565 (or 40441558 counting only the distinct ones).
The product of its digits is 54432, while the sum is 45.
The square root of 2911791816 is about 53961.0212653541. The cubic root of 2911791816 is about 1427.9733653201.
It can be divided in two parts, 291179 and 1816, that added together give a triangular number (292995 = T765).
The spelling of 2911791816 in words is "two billion, nine hundred eleven million, seven hundred ninety-one thousand, eight hundred sixteen".
